First Aid Care Is The First Step in Potentially Life Saving Moments

Having first aid supplies on hand at home can allow you to be prepared in the case of an accident, injury or sudden illness. There are many first aid kits that you can purchase that allow you to conveniently and securely store your first aid supplies so that they are easy to transport and ready to use. You can also use a plastic container or tackle box to contain your first aid supplies. Make sure to keep your first aid kit in a safe location in your home so that it will be ready and accessible when needed. A first aid kit is also a must if you are traveling. Accidents happen no matter where you are so you should have a first aid kit in your vehicle in case of emergencies.

First Aid Kit Basics

You should stock your first aid kit with the following supplies:

  • First aid manual - A first aid kit manual should include instructions on how and when to use certain supplies. It should also include expiration dates of medications and supplies. Keep a list of emergency contact numbers including poison control and your family doctor.
  • Sterile gauze dressings - You will want to have gauze available in a variety of different sizes.
  • Bandages - You should have a wide variety of bandages in different sizes and shapes.
  • Safety pins - Safety pins can be used to keep dressings and bandages in place securely and easily.
  • Tweezers - Tweezers should be sterilized before use. They can be used to remove slivers, shards of glass and other debris from cuts and scrapes.
  • Cleansing wipes - Cleansing wipes are very important because they can remove harmful bacteria from wounds.

Common First Aid Kit Uses

First aid kits are very helpful to have on hand because you can provide immediate initial care to someone who is injured or sick. A few of the most common reasons you should have first aid supplies include:

Wound

A wound refers to an injury that may be caused by a cut, impact or scrape. Wound include abrasions, lacerations, avulsions, and punctures. Wounds can be mild or serious, depending on the size and depth of the injury. It is very important to tend to a wound promptly and properly to prevent the risk of infection.

Wound Care

If you have a minor wound you should be able to care for it at home. It is very important to clean a wound to remove all dirt and debris. You will also want to apply direct pressure to the wound to help control bleeding and reduce swelling. Once the wound has been cleaned you will want to use a sterile dressing or bandage (depending on the size of the wound). You will want to make sure that your wound is healing and will want to change the dressings daily. You will want to see the doctor if your wound is deep, the bleeding does not stop, or your wound is slow to heal.

Infected Finger

An infected finger is a common injury. Infections can be mild or serious, but it is always important to make sure that you treat it promptly. Finger infections can occur for a wide variety of reasons including cuts, animal bites and puncture wounds. It is important to effectively clean cuts and wounds to prevent bacteria from causing an infection. Having first aid supplies on hand can allow you to treat finger infections easily and quickly, preventing infections from getting worse. Antibiotic creams and wound dressings can help to effectively treat wounds and infections. If your finger infection persists, you should see your doctor for further treatment.

You should review the contents of your first aid kit on an annual basis to ensure that it does not need to be restocked, and that expired supplies are replaced. A first aid kit is extremely helpful in the case of a health issue or accident.
